FSS opens public consultation on draft strategy for 2021-2026

Food Standards Scotland (FSS) has opened a public consultation on its proposals for its new strategy for 2021-26. The draft strategy is titled ‘Protecting Scotland in a Changing Food Environment’ and identifies FSS’s proposed key priorities for the next five years....

FSS recommends eating out should be a healthier experience

Food Standards Scotland (FSS) has called for significant changes to make food outside of the home healthier. FSS believes implementing these evidence-based recommendations is a positive and necessary step towards shaping the Scottish Government’s Out of Home Strategy...
